Summary
Drawing titled: “Renovation work at Cliveden House”. The info on the appendix to the 1990 lease gives the description: January 1986, in intense cold. The north front is undergoing repairs, part of the comprehensive work of the restoration of the house. In the foreground are cylindrical blocks of asphalt and the boiler in which they were melted before being laid on the roof. The pencil on paper drawing is close framed with glass glazing in a reverse bolection oak moulding with an inner slip frame painted black with a white scumble.
